
Little is known about the driver accused of killing one person and injuring 16 others on the Venice boardwalk, Los Angeles police said. Public records indicate Nathan Louis Campbell, 38, lived in Georgia, Florida and most recently Colorado and had a history of arrests for petty crimes, the Los Angeles Times reported. The 2008 Dodge Avenger Campbell was driving when he ran over an Italian woman and injured 16 pedestrians had been purchased from a dealership in Littleton, Colo., recently, police said. He is being held on $1 million bond in the death of Alice Gruppioni, 32, who was on her honeymoon when she was killed. Investigators were examining Campbell's background to determine a motive for the Saturday attack. Nearly two decades ago Campbell lived in Hollywood at Covenant House, which provides services and housing for homeless youths. He came to Los Angeles recently and police said it is unclear how he spent the intervening years. The Los Angeles County district attorney's office was expected to file charges against Campbell Tuesday.
